Classic Hawaiian Sweet Rolls

Classic Hawaiian sweet rolls are made with a simple dough of flour, sugar, yeast, milk, and butter. The dough is then rolled out and cut into small rounds, which are placed in a greased baking dish. The rolls are allowed to rise until they’re double in size, then baked until they’re golden brown.

Classic Hawaiian sweet rolls are perfect for breakfast or brunch. They can be served plain or with butter, jam, or honey. You can also use them to make sandwiches or sliders.

Here’s a recipe for classic Hawaiian sweet rolls:

  1. In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, and yeast.
  2. In a separate bowl, whisk together the milk and butter. Heat the mixture until the butter is melted and the milk is warm.
  3.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and stir until a dough forms.
  4. Turn the dough out onto a floured surface and knead for 5-7 minutes, until it is smooth and elastic.
  5.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with plastic wrap, and let it rise in a warm place for 1 hour, or until it has doubled in size.
  6. Punch down the dough and divide it into 12 equal pieces.
  7. Shape the dough pieces into rolls and place them in a greased 9×13 inch baking dish.
  8. Cover the rolls with plastic wrap and let them rise in a warm place for 30 minutes, or until they have doubled in size.
  9.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  10. Bake the rolls for 15-20 minutes, or until they are golden brown.
  11. Let the rolls cool in the pan for a few minutes before serving.

Filled Hawaiian Sweet Rolls

Filled Hawaiian sweet rolls are a great way to add a little extra flavor and excitement to your breakfast or brunch. You can fill them with anything you like, such as fruit, nuts, cheese, or meat. Here are a few ideas for filled Hawaiian sweet rolls:

  • Fruit-filled Hawaiian sweet rolls: Fill your rolls with your favorite fruit, such as strawberries, blueberries, raspberries, or bananas.
  • Nut-filled Hawaiian sweet rolls: Fill your rolls with chopped nuts, such as almonds, walnuts, pecans, or macadamia nuts.
  • Cheese-filled Hawaiian sweet rolls: Fill your rolls with your favorite cheese, such as cheddar, mozzarella, or cream cheese.
  • Meat-filled Hawaiian sweet rolls: Fill your rolls with cooked meat, such as ham, bacon, or sausage.

To fill your Hawaiian sweet rolls, simply make a small incision in the top of each roll and insert your filling. You can then brush the rolls with melted butter and sprinkle them with cinnamon sugar before baking.

Savory Hawaiian Sweet Rolls

Savory Hawaiian sweet rolls are a great way to enjoy the flavors of Hawaii without the sweetness. They’re perfect for lunch or dinner, and they can be served with a variety of dishes. Here are a few ideas for savory Hawaiian sweet rolls:

  • Garlic Hawaiian sweet rolls: Brush your rolls with garlic oil before baking.
  • Herb Hawaiian sweet rolls: Add chopped herbs, such as basil, oregano, or thyme, to your dough.
  • Cheese Hawaiian sweet rolls: Fill your rolls with your favorite cheese, such as cheddar, mozzarella, or goat cheese.
  • Bacon Hawaiian sweet rolls: Add crumbled bacon to your dough.

To make savory Hawaiian sweet rolls, simply follow the recipe for classic Hawaiian sweet rolls and add your desired flavorings. You can then brush the rolls with melted butter and sprinkle them with salt and pepper before baking.
